About Pipeline Intelligence Group

Pipeline Intelligence Group (PIG) is an early-stage industrial AI company deploying edge-based anomaly detection and real-time monitoring systems for midstream pipeline operators. Our platform fuses live SCADA data with external intelligence feeds — NOAA weather, USGS seismic, wildfire perimeter data, and 811 dig-alert notifications — processed locally on NVIDIA Jetson edge hardware with AI reasoning layered on top.

We are currently focused on the Beaumont–Port Arthur–Liberty, Texas pipeline corridor and are seeking a technical co-founder to own our operational technology integration stack from the ground up.

The Role

This is not a corporate IT position. You will be the person who physically connects our edge hardware to active pipeline SCADA systems, configures read-only OPC-UA data feeds, validates sensor data integrity, and ensures our platform speaks the same as the RTUs, PLCs, and DCS controllers running in the field.

You will work directly with the founder and be the first technical hire. Your fingerprints will be on the architecture from day one.

Core Responsibilities

  • Design and implement read-only OPC-UA client connections to pipeline operator SCADA systems (Ignition, Wonderware, OSIsoft PI, or equivalent)
  • Configure and validate data ingestion from RTUs and PLCs using industrial protocols including OPC-UA, Modbus TCP/RTU, and DNP3
  • Deploy and commission NVIDIA Jetson Orin edge hardware at or near pipeline operator facilities
  • Integrate edge AI inference layer (local LLM on Ollama) with SCADA data streams via our OpenClaw orchestration framework
  • Develop and maintain OPC-UA node browsing, tag mapping, and data normalization pipelines
  • Coordinate with pipeline operator control room staff and IT/OT teams to establish secure, non-intrusive parallel data feeds
  • Validate data quality, sensor health, and alarm state accuracy against PHMSA Integrity Management Program requirements
  • Build out documentation covering integration architecture, tag dictionaries, and operator configuration templates

Non-Negotiable Requirements

If you cannot answer yes to each of the following, this role is not for you:

  • 3+ years of hands-on OPC-UA implementation experience (client configuration, node browsing, tag mapping, server connectivity)
  • Direct experience with SCADA platforms — Ignition (Inductive Automation), Wonderware/AVEVA, OSIsoft PI, FactoryTalk, or equivalent
  • Field experience with industrial control systems: RTUs, PLCs, or DCS in pipeline, oil & gas, utilities, water/wastewater, or heavy manufacturing environments
  • Proficiency with at least one additional industrial protocol beyond OPC-UA (Modbus TCP/RTU, DNP3, Profibus, EtherNet/IP, or similar)
  • Ability to read and interpret P&IDs, instrument datasheets, and control system architecture drawings
  • Understanding of IT/OT network segmentation, DMZ architecture, and read-only data historian concepts

Strongly

  • Experience in midstream pipeline operations, natural gas transmission, or petroleum liquid transport
  • Familiarity with PHMSA 49 CFR Part 192/195 Integrity Management Program requirements
  • Experience with edge computing hardware deployment in industrial environments (ruggedized hardware, DIN rail mounting, field enclosures)
  • Linux administration skills (Ubuntu) for edge hardware configuration and maintenance
  • Exposure to AI/ML inference at the edge, MQTT, or time-series data platforms (InfluxDB, OSIsoft PI)
  • ISA/IEC 62443 cybersecurity awareness for industrial control systems
